1. An earpiece comprising:
an electro-acoustic transducer;
a housing supporting the electro-acoustic transducer such that the housing and the electro-acoustic transducer together define a first acoustic volume and a second acoustic volume, the electro-acoustic transducer being arranged such that a first radiating surface of the transducer radiates acoustic energy into the first acoustic volume and such that a second radiating surface of the transducer radiates acoustic energy into the second acoustic volume;
a mesh disposed along an outlet of the housing and arranged to inhibit debris from entering the first acoustic volume;
a first microphone supported in the housing, the first microphone comprising a first microphone port for sensing pressure; and
a chimney surrounding the first microphone port and mechanically coupling the first microphone to the mesh,
wherein the chimney is secured directly to the mesh via adhesive or heat staking.
